BYU may refer to:

Education

* Brigham Young University, a university located in Provo, Utah, USA administered by The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ints.
**BYU Salt Lake Center, a satellite center in Salt Lake City, Utah, USA
**Brigham Young University Jerusalem Center, a satellite campus in Jerusalem.
*Brigham Young University Hawaii, a sister school in Laie, Hawaii, USA
*Brigham Young University-Idaho, a sister school in Rexburg, Idaho, USA

Animation

* Brigham Young University movie (filename extension: .byu), a computer vector animation file format

Aviation

* Bindlacher Berg Airport (IATA airport code: BYU) in Bayreuth, Germany.

Language

* Buyang (ISO639 identifier: byu), a language of China
